Property Marketed by Hudson Place Realty - The wait is over for this singular 2960 sq. ft. corner penthouse in the Historic Jefferson Trust Bank building. The one of a kind architectural elements featured in this circa 1900 beauty include a 23 ft. ceiling graced with the original 20’ x 20’ stained glass back lit skylight, the restored Jefferson Trust Bank clock, ornate plaster moldings, and the stunning original wrought iron window grates. Flawlessly designed, the space at 313 First Street offers a classic aesthetic with ultra modern amenities. Choose the elevator with direct keyed access into your home or enter through your private foyer into the lavish 46.7’ x 30.7’ sq. ft. great room. The kitchen is open yet set back from the living/entertaining space and distinguished by a semi-circular ceiling. Top-of the line appliances include; gas Viking 6 burner range The master suite features a large private spa bath and many closets. A dramatic mezzanine level spans the entire length of your home and overlooks the vast living area. With a 2nd bedroom, media room and full bath the mezzanine level is the perfect urban sanctuary. 2 garage parking spots are included in the price and an A+ Path friendly location

Electrical labor to install Wallbox charger for Tesla EV. Ran copper wire from panel to desired charger location.
Relocated location of breaker box to be positioned higher than existing meter stands to allow for future expansion by other owners.
Utilized a single breaker box that can support four (4) separate circuits rated at 50A each. The sub-panel will have the provisions for those breakers.
Run conduit lines in parallel and as close as possible to to existing conduits.

Charles E. Roberts Stable (Wright, c. 1900; Charles E. White remodel, 1929)
A secluded Tudor Revival cottage, once a stable then garage adapted by White to a residence.
